
For Honor is a groundbreaking team-based PvP melee fighting game where Knights, Samurai, Vikings, Wu Lin, and more clash in endless battles. Pick unique heroes and master intense 4v4, 2v2, or 1v1 battles.

Every price cut of more than 20% we have observed, in each market that quoted one, with this game's chart position on either side of it. These are episodes, not a model: a sale is one event, and one event cannot tell you what the next one will do.
Reviews, worldwide (the counter carries no country): 23.57/day in the week to Jul 24 → 39.86/day in the week after.
For scale, across Steam · Top Sellers · Brazil over the last 30 days: the 25 chart moves that followed a price cut of more than 20% went a median of 10 places towards #1, and the 2,413 moves with no price cut behind them went 2 away. One store, one chart, one country — it is the only place we have enough observations to say even that.

Ending support for Linux after nearly 10 years? Guess I can't play the game I paid for any longer without paying for an operating system that was previously NOT REQUIRED to play the game. If this is for ranked dominion, why is it affecting all game modes including offline play? Now I won't even be able to launch the game I OWN and HAVE OWNED? Not to mention that this won't completely stop cheaters (the supposed reason for this change) and will instead virtually revoke access to the game for many legitimate players who have supported the game for years. What an absolute dishonest, inconsiderate mess of a decision
